Proactive Investors - NVIDIA Corp (NASDAQ:NVDA) has told Chinese customers it is delaying the launch of a new artificial intelligence (AI) chip, H20, until the first quarter of 2025, Reuters reported on Friday, citing two sources familiar with the matter.

H20, the most powerful of three China-focused chips Nvidia has developed to comply with US export restrictions, is purportedly being delayed because server vendors were having problems integrating the semiconductor, the media outlet noted.

Wedbush Securities analysts, in an update to clients, noted that they "struggle somewhat" with the explanation given the part's reduced specifications, which should make it easier to integrate within a system.

"Given NVIDIA's strong backlog in other regions, we don't see delays as particularly impactful to near-term revenues or earnings," the analysts wrote.

"However, over the intermediate term, we view NVIDIA's ability to ship into China as potentially meaningful in determining how long NVIDIA supply remains below demand and at what level revenues peak during the current cycle," they added.

The delay could complicate its efforts to preserve market share in China against local rivals like Huawei, according to Reuters.

Nvidia has also been planning two other chips, the L20 and L2, to comply with new US export rules, however, L20 is still expected to launch this quarter.

Shares of Nvidia slipped 0.8% to $483.51 in early trading on Friday.
